The React. js "Uncaught TypeError: X is not a function" occurs when we try to call a value that is not a function as a function, e.g. calling the props object instead of a function. To solve the error, console. log the value you are calling and make sure it is a function.
To update your React version, install the latest versions of the react and react-dom packages by running npm install react@latest react-dom@latest . If you use create-react-app , also update the version of react-scripts . Copied! The command will update the versions of the react-related packages.
To check which React version is your project using you need to open the package. json. Take a look under the dependencies section. It should list all of the dependencies of your project and one of those should be React.
React hooks are available in React v16.8.0. updated your react and react dom version to 16.8.0.
"react": "16.8.0",
"react-dom": "16.8.0",
